diff --git a/R-package/src/xgboost_custom.cc b/R-package/src/xgboost_custom.cc index f196297ec..92f8a8e1f 100644 --- a/R-package/src/xgboost_custom.cc +++ b/R-package/src/xgboost_custom.cc @@ -32,7 +32,7 @@ namespace common { bool CheckNAN(double v) { return ISNAN(v); } -#if !defined(XGBOOST_USE_CUDA) +#if !defined(XGBOOST_USE_CUDA) && !defined(XGBOOST_USE_HIP) double LogGamma(double v) { return lgammafn(v); } diff --git a/python-package/packager/build_config.py b/python-package/packager/build_config.py index 26392a897..517dc17f0 100644 --- a/python-package/packager/build_config.py +++ b/python-package/packager/build_config.py @@ -15,6 +15,10 @@ class BuildConfiguration: # pylint: disable=R0902 use_cuda: bool = False # Whether to enable NCCL use_nccl: bool = False + # Whether to enablea HIP + use_hip: bool = False + # Whether to enable RCCL + use_rccl: bool = False # Whether to enable HDFS use_hdfs: bool = False # Whether to enable Azure Storage